Top Departments Currently Hiring Officer-Level Posts
Here’s a breakdown of some of the major departments currently offering officer jobs:
- Union Public Service Commission (UPSC): Offering roles like IAS, IPS, IFS, and other prestigious All India Services.
- Staff Selection Commission (SSC): Recruits officers through exams like SSC CGL for roles in Income Tax and Customs.
- Reserve Bank of India (RBI): Conducts exams for Grade B Officers—a big hit among finance graduates.
- National Bank for Agriculture and Rural Development (NABARD): Offers Assistant Manager posts.
- Public Sector Banks: Through IBPS & SBI exams for roles like Probationary Officer (PO).
- Indian Railways: Hiring Group A Officers via the Railway Recruitment Boards.
Who Can Apply?
Each department and post may have its own eligibility requirements, but in general, the following criteria apply:
- Educational Qualification: Most officer posts require a minimum of a bachelor’s degree. Some technical positions may ask for B.E./B.Tech or equivalent.
- Age Limit: Typically 21–30 years, depending on the role and category. Age relaxation applies as per government norms.
- Nationality: Candidates must be Indian citizens. Some exceptions exist for special categories.
It’s always a good idea to read the official notification for complete details and eligibility clauses before applying.

What Exams Do You Need to Clear?
Most officer jobs require candidates to qualify through a competitive examination, followed by an interview or document verification. Some of the popular exams include:
- UPSC Civil Services Examination
- SSC Combined Graduate Level (CGL)
- IBPS PO and SO Exams
- SBI PO Exam
- RBI Grade B
- NABARD Officers Exam
- RRB Group A & B Exams
Preparation is key! Many successful candidates crack these exams by following a disciplined study plan, taking mock tests, and practicing previous year papers.
